ESCsmart - Electronic Stability Control

ZF’s ESCsmartTM Electronic Stability Control system supports the driver to keep the vehicle stable especially in dynamic driving manoeuvres. With over 3 million vehicles across the world installed with ZF’s ESCsmart, the solution combines anti-lock brakes (ABS) and traction control with a lateral stability control function. The system automatically intervenes where vehicle stability enters a critical phase and helps to protect the vehicle against rollover, skidding and – in case of a truck-trailer combination - jack-knifing.​

Electronic Braking System

ZF’s Electronic Braking System (EBS) is an advanced brake control technology that transfers the driver’s deceleration request electronically to all braking system components to shorten response time, balance brake forces and provide efficient brake management between service and endurance brakes. Anti-lock Braking System

ZF hydraulic & pneumatic anti-lock braking systems (ABS) assist drivers in situations where combinations of road friction, road curvature and vehicle speed result in an unfavourable wheel slip. With over millions of vehicles across the world installed with ZF’s ABS, the system helps to automatically intervene to keep the vehicle stable and controllable in a wide range of different manoeuvres. ZF's Hill Start Aid is an added function that prevents vehicles from unintended rollbacks while driving on slopes and maximizes driver safety and comfort.

Trailer Electronic Braking System

By intelligently processing data provided by various trailer sensors, ZF’s Trailer Electronic Braking System (TEBS) determines whether the current vehicle dynamics are unsafe or inefficient and triggers countermeasures by actively warning the vehicle operator and, where possible, directing the actuation of brake and/or suspension controls to bring the vehicle back to the desired safe and efficient state. Reverse Park Assist System

ZF’s Reverse Parking Assist System monitors stationary and moving objects behind the vehicle, including pedestrians, vehicles, cargo, and infrastructure. Fitted with 4 sensors and a buzzer, the system uses ultrasonic technology to sense the distance of the obstacle from the vehicle. On sensing the distance, a buzzer alerts the driver through a series of warning sounds of varying pitch and frequency, to slow down or stop the vehicle to prevent impending collisions.

Driver Behaviour Monitoring System

ZF’s Driver Behaviour Monitoring System uses a camera mounted on the dashboard to track driver drowsiness or distraction, and issues a warning or alert to get the driver’s attention back to the task of driving. Based on a dual camera system, the system monitors the road and driver status during driving and issues warnings in advance to reduce the risk of accidents. The data is uploaded to the cloud management to measure driver risk assessment and ensure a safer driving experience. Additionally, the system also issues forward collision warning & lane departure warnings.

Connectivity & telematics

ZF’s connectivity solutions empower fleet owners with real-time data to enhance safety of commercial vehicles. Adopting advanced technological solution empowers fleet managers to take effective actions to maximize safety. Here are a few ways in which connectivity and telematics contribute to safety:
  • Real-time monitoring: Telematics systems can provide real-time data on a wide range of vehicle parameters, such as speed, location, and braking patterns. This information can be used to monitor driver behaviour and identify potential safety hazards. For example, if a driver is consistently speeding or braking too hard, telematics data can help to identify this problem and take steps to correct it.
  • Remote diagnostics: Telematics provide real-time diagnostics of the vehicle's systems and provide alerts on potential problems or issues; this can help the fleet manager to proactively schedule the maintenance of the vehicle and ensure it is safe to operate.
  • Predictive maintenance: By collecting real-time data on vehicle health and performance, telematics systems can help to predict when maintenance is required, and schedule the maintenance before it becomes a safety concern.

Trailer Anti-lock Braking System

The trailer ABS controls wheel slip to ensure trailer stability and steerability during braking. It prevents wheels from locking and slows down the vehicle as far as possible within physical limits.
